Json deserialization would leave 112001 in the date property. Reads one json value including objects or arrays from the provided reader and converts it into an instance of a specified type. We would like to show you a description here but the site wont allow us. Lets say we have this json but we need to deserialize only the image part and not the entire object we need to access the path widget. I simply check whether the json being serialized is an object or an array. Notice how the array contains similar objects, two vehicles. If it is an object, i know that the user requested the totals, so i extract the various paging information properties, and deserialize the users property of the json object to a list of user. Imagine you need to process some json that looks like this. Deserialize readonlyspan, jsonserializeroptions parses the utf8 encoded text representing a single json value into an instance of the type specified by a generic type parameter. Json supports only public parameterless constructors. This article shows how to deserialize json into a collection of objects of dynamic types with json. Each vehicle has a type property that identifies the specific type of vehicle.
The voiceless palatal fricative is a type of consonantal sound used in some spoken languages. An attempt was made to convert a json array to an array like managed type that is not supported for use as a json deserialization target. Net 2 as youve correctly diagnosed in your update, the issue is that the json has a closing followed immediately by an opening to start the next set. In our case, since companies isnt a json array, how do you deserialize it to the. So it becomes necessary to learn pointers to become a perfect c programmer.
You can even just deserialize into a dynamic object, but its always better to create your own classes, just as you have done update. Logical operators in c following table shows all the logical operators supported by c language. Some c programming tasks are performed more easily with pointers, and other tasks, such as dynamic memory allocation, cannot be performed without using pointers. You can divide up your code into separate functions. C programming is a generalpurpose, procedural, imperative computer programming language developed in 1972 by dennis m. To explain this, let us consider the following json array string. Ordered list of values it includes array, list, vector or sequence etc. The symbol in the international phonetic alphabet that represents this sound is. My problem is, that the data is not available in an json array. I have been fighting this one for a bit now, cant get the type casting right. The examples assume the json is in a byte array named jsonutf8bytes.
Add kosher salt to the boiling water, then add the pasta. Parsing json dynamically rather than statically serializing into objects is. Net how to deserialize a collection of objects for which we only know the base type, while the actual type needs to be determined during the transformation, based on json data. Similarly structure is another user defined data type available in c that allows to combine data items of different kinds. Every c program has at least one function, which is main, and all the most trivial programs can define additional functions. A function is a group of statements that together perform a task.
New york including stock price, stock chart, company news, key statistics, fundamentals and company profile. C is a simpler, tightlydefined alternative to c which does support all of these things. Deseriliazing json array without predefining attributes. Em destaque no meta the q1 2020 community roadmap is on the blog. How you divide up your code among different functions. For objects and arrays you have to explicitly create new jobject or jarray. Always ensure that you have guard clauseschecks in place before you try to get a member from an dynamic object. You can deserialise an array but you have to deserialize into a list object. I want to use only one datacontract to deserialize these jsons as there are many more like that. Assume variable a holds 1 and variable b holds 0, then. I think your problem is about how to deserilize a json string which contains a list with some different types of the instance which are deriving from a same parent class. Question was about deserializing to dynamic object jobject is dynamic but contains own types like jvalue not primitive types.